How To Fix /PM0/3FL_NEWS_CLASS020 - The second letter of the flag should be F


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/PM0/3FL_NEWS_CLASS -

  • Message number: 020

  • Message text: The second letter of the flag should be F

    The SAP error message /PM0/3FL_NEWS_CLASS020 with the description "The second letter of the flag should be F" typically relates to issues in the configuration or data entry within the SAP system, particularly in the context of the PM (Plant Maintenance) module or related functionalities.

    Cause:

    This error usually occurs when a specific flag or code is expected to follow a certain format, and the second character of that flag does not meet the required criteria. In this case, the system expects the second letter of the flag to be 'F', but it is not. This could be due to:

    1. Incorrect Data Entry: The user may have entered a flag or code incorrectly.
    2. Configuration Issues: There may be a misconfiguration in the system settings or parameters that define valid flags.
    3. Custom Development: If there are custom programs or enhancements, they might not be handling the flag correctly.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check the Input: Review the flag or code you are trying to enter. Ensure that the second character is indeed 'F'. Correct any typos or mistakes.

    2. Review Configuration: If you have access to the configuration settings, check the relevant settings for the flags or codes in the PM module. Ensure that they are set up correctly according to the business requirements.

    3. Consult Documentation: Look into the SAP documentation or help files related to the specific transaction or process you are working with. This may provide insights into the expected formats for flags.

    4. Debug Custom Code: If there are custom developments involved, you may need to debug the code to identify where the flag is being set and why it does not conform to the expected format.

    5. Contact Support: If you are unable to resolve the issue, consider reaching out to your SAP support team or consulting with SAP support for further assistance.
